module QuicQuid.Log( module System.Log.Logger ,module System.Log.Handler.Simple ,err ) where import System.Log.Logger import System.Log.Handler.Simple -- |Log an error message and then throw an exception err :: String -- ^ The logger name -> String -- ^ The message -> IO () err pos msg = do errorM pos msg error $ pos ++ ": " ++ msg